Item #1: SOLD First up is a one of a kind Milky mod (modified by member Milkyspit aka Scott) which uses a neutral tint Rebel 100 LED behind an optic to deliver a large, even hotspot with ample spill. The hotspot from this head is even bigger than from a stock Surefire optic, which makes it extremely useful. The host was a later generation KL1. The Rebel 100 is rated up to 1 amp, which is the highest among available single die neutral tint LEDs. The custom firmware Milky programmed drives it at 1 amp on high, 600mA on medium, 150mA on low, and 25mA on lowest.

The firmware is based off of the 'Califon' standard, which provides the user with 3 groups of user interfaces (UIs) to choose from. The first is memory mode, which simply remembers the last mode you used and begins there when next you turn it on. To change between the 4 brightness levels, just tap the switch to cycle through and then hold or click the switch for more than 1/2 second when you get to the level you want. Second is tactical mode, in which the light always comes on in the highest output level first, then cycles to strobe before continuing down the progression to medium, low, and lowest before repeating. In theatre mode, the light always comes on lowest first and progresses upwards in brightness as you cycle.

To switch between the 3 UIs, you tap the switch >20 times (but <40) without keeping the switch on for more than 1/2 second. As with the 'Califon' firmware, this light also has miser mode, which reduces all of the output levels by a factor of 6 to increase runtime. To switch to miser mode and back, you tap the switch >40 times without keeping the switch on for more than 1/2 second. It is really very easy to switch modes by just bouncing your finger off of the switch.

For this firmware, I decided to take the strobe and locater flash modes out of the UIs with the exception of the tactical mode. So, when cycling through the levels in either the theatre or memory modes I don't have to cycle through an annoying strobe or locater flash. I decided to leave strobe in the tactical mode as the second setting after high. None of my UIs contain a locater flash. What I really like about my firmware is that I can access strobe and two different locater flash modes at any time, from within any UI, by using a 'gesture'. If I tap 6 times I get strobe, 7 times for the bright locater, and 8 times for a dim locater.

Item #2 SOLD Next, I have for sale here a Surefire KL1 head in HA natural finish which I have modified as follows:
-4000K color temperature high CRI Seoul LED mounted with AA thermal epoxy on a copper shim for proper focus
-IMS 20mm smooth reflector for good throw but ample spill - the reflector was slightly cut down for proper fit and focus
-Modified original KL1 circuit to increase LED drive level - 560mA on one Li-ion or 750mA on 2 primaries, 2 Li-ion or 3 primaries
-Head is sealed with medium strength Loctite

This head is in excellent condition as you can see from the photos below. It is not 100% though, I would rate it at 97% due to some very slight anodizing wear in a few places at the bezel - but you have to be looking for it to see it. This light does an excellent job at rendering colors due to the use of the high CRI LED. Because of the boost/buck KL1 circuitry it can run off of many battery choices up to 9V input.
